Computerized Maintenance Management System (CMMS) Software in Healthcare Market size was valued at USD 1.5 Billion in 2022 and is projected to reach USD 3.2 Billion by 2030, growing at a CAGR of 10.0% from 2024 to 2030.
The Computerized Maintenance Management System (CMMS) software in the healthcare market has gained significant traction due to the growing need for efficient management of healthcare assets, equipment, and facilities. These systems provide healthcare organizations with the tools to streamline maintenance tasks, ensuring the continuous operation of critical healthcare infrastructure. CMMS software is designed to automate maintenance processes, track maintenance histories, and manage service schedules, reducing downtime and extending the lifespan of medical equipment. The software's use in healthcare settings such as hospitals, clinics, and other healthcare facilities is increasing rapidly, as it supports a wide array of functions, from compliance management to energy savings. With healthcare facilities being critical to public health and safety, the role of CMMS software has become more central in enhancing operational efficiencies and improving patient care quality.

Hospitals represent the largest segment for the adoption of Computerized Maintenance Management System (CMMS) software in the healthcare sector. As hospitals operate a diverse range of medical equipment, from diagnostic machines to life-support systems, efficient maintenance is crucial to ensuring the safety of patients and the reliability of services. CMMS in hospitals enables the systematic tracking and scheduling of preventive maintenance for critical equipment, which can significantly reduce the risk of equipment failure and improve operational uptime. Moreover, the automation of maintenance workflows in hospitals ensures compliance with strict regulatory standards, such as those mandated by the Food and Drug Administration (FDA) and other healthcare authorities, ensuring that hospitals meet safety and quality standards. Hospitals also face increasing pressures related to cost management, and CMMS software helps by optimizing resource allocation, reducing unnecessary repairs, and prolonging the lifespan of high-cost medical assets. By tracking the real-time performance of equipment and systems, CMMS provides hospital management teams with invaluable data, enabling them to make informed decisions on equipment replacement, repairs, and procurement strategies. In a competitive healthcare market where patient care and cost-effectiveness are paramount, hospitals leveraging CMMS software are positioned to enhance operational efficiency and patient satisfaction, ultimately contributing to better health outcomes.
The clinics segment is also witnessing considerable growth in the adoption of CMMS software as a means to improve asset management and maintenance practices. Clinics, though typically smaller in scale than hospitals, also rely on critical medical equipment to provide quality patient care. CMMS software helps clinic operators manage maintenance schedules for equipment such as diagnostic tools, lab instruments, and HVAC systems, ensuring that they are serviced on time and operate efficiently. With smaller budgets and fewer staff, clinics benefit from the automation capabilities of CMMS, allowing them to reduce the burden on maintenance personnel and ensure that equipment issues are addressed before they lead to costly downtimes. Clinics also face unique challenges when it comes to regulatory compliance and ensuring the safety of patients. CMMS software enables clinics to meet these challenges by keeping a detailed history of maintenance activities, which is crucial for audits and inspections. Additionally, CMMS allows clinics to track the performance and condition of their medical assets, assisting them in planning for equipment upgrades or replacements and optimizing their resources. As healthcare services continue to evolve, the role of CMMS software in improving asset management and supporting regulatory compliance in clinics is set to expand, driving operational efficiencies and improving patient care quality.
The “Others” segment in the Computerized Maintenance Management System (CMMS) software market encompasses a variety of healthcare-related facilities, such as diagnostic centers, long-term care facilities, rehabilitation centers, and outpatient facilities, which are increasingly adopting CMMS to optimize their operations. These facilities, although not as large or complex as hospitals, require robust asset and maintenance management systems to ensure the reliability of their medical equipment and overall facility operations. CMMS software in this segment allows organizations to perform preventive maintenance, monitor asset performance, and track inventory, ensuring that critical equipment remains in peak operating condition without unnecessary delays or failures. The adoption of CMMS in the “Others” segment also supports better regulatory compliance, particularly for healthcare centers that must meet specific standards for patient safety and equipment efficacy. By centralizing maintenance data and automating workflows, CMMS software helps these healthcare providers stay compliant with industry regulations while reducing the administrative burden on their teams. Furthermore, with the increasing demand for outpatient care, diagnostic testing, and rehabilitation services, CMMS software provides these facilities with a tool for improving service delivery, reducing operational costs, and enhancing overall patient satisfaction.
One of the key trends driving the growth of CMMS software in the healthcare market is the increasing demand for preventive maintenance. Healthcare facilities are shifting away from reactive maintenance to proactive approaches to minimize downtime and ensure the continuous availability of essential medical equipment. With preventive maintenance, organizations can reduce the likelihood of unexpected equipment failures, which can result in expensive repairs or operational disruptions. Furthermore, CMMS software is increasingly integrating with the Internet of Things (IoT) to enhance real-time monitoring and predictive analytics, enabling healthcare facilities to identify potential issues before they cause significant problems. Another trend in the market is the increasing adoption of cloud-based CMMS solutions. Cloud computing offers significant advantages for healthcare organizations, particularly in terms of cost savings, scalability, and ease of access. Cloud-based CMMS solutions allow healthcare providers to access maintenance data and dashboards remotely, enabling more efficient asset management across multiple locations. Additionally, the growing focus on data analytics and artificial intelligence in CMMS platforms is helping healthcare organizations make data-driven decisions related to asset management and resource allocation. By leveraging AI and machine learning algorithms, healthcare providers can gain deeper insights into equipment performance and optimize their maintenance strategies accordingly.
The CMMS software market in healthcare presents several opportunities for growth, particularly in emerging economies where the healthcare infrastructure is rapidly developing. As hospitals, clinics, and other healthcare facilities in these regions expand, there is a rising need for efficient maintenance systems to manage medical equipment and improve operational efficiencies. Vendors offering affordable and scalable CMMS solutions tailored to the needs of these markets can capitalize on the growing demand for healthcare modernization and infrastructure development. Another key opportunity lies in the integration of CMMS software with other healthcare management systems, such as Electronic Health Records (EHR) and Hospital Information Systems (HIS). The seamless integration of CMMS with these systems can provide a more holistic approach to healthcare management, ensuring that maintenance activities are aligned with patient care priorities. Additionally, the increasing emphasis on sustainability and energy efficiency in healthcare facilities presents an opportunity for CMMS vendors to develop solutions that help healthcare providers optimize energy usage, reduce waste, and lower operational costs while maintaining high standards of patient care.
What is CMMS software in healthcare?
CMMS (Computerized Maintenance Management System) software is used by healthcare organizations to automate maintenance processes, track equipment health, and ensure operational efficiency.
Why is CMMS important for hospitals?
CMMS is crucial for hospitals as it helps reduce equipment downtime, improve asset lifespan, and ensure compliance with regulatory standards.
What are the benefits of using CMMS in clinics?
In clinics, CMMS software improves maintenance scheduling, reduces downtime, and ensures the reliability of medical equipment.
How does CMMS software enhance patient care?
CMMS software ensures that medical equipment is well-maintained, preventing failures that could disrupt patient care and improving the overall service quality.
What industries use CMMS software?
CMMS software is used across various industries, including healthcare, manufacturing, and facilities management, to optimize asset maintenance and improve operational efficiency.
What is predictive maintenance in CMMS?
Predictive maintenance in CMMS uses data analytics and real-time monitoring to predict equipment failures before they occur, allowing proactive maintenance interventions.
Is cloud-based CMMS better than on-premise solutions?
Cloud-based CMMS offers benefits such as remote access, scalability, and reduced infrastructure costs compared to traditional on-premise solutions.
Can CMMS be integrated with other healthcare systems?
Yes, CMMS can be integrated with Electronic Health Records (EHR) and Hospital Information Systems (HIS) to streamline maintenance and patient care processes.
What is the role of CMMS in regulatory compliance?
CMMS helps healthcare organizations maintain accurate maintenance records, ensuring compliance with healthcare regulations and standards.
What future trends are expected in CMMS for healthcare?
The integration of IoT, AI, and cloud-based solutions will drive the future of CMMS in healthcare, offering predictive analytics and enhanced decision-making capabilities.
